Factors Influencing International Movers Cost in Nicaragua

  • Distance and Destination: The distance to Nicaragua international movers destination plays a significant role in determining your international moving costs. Moving to a neighboring country in Central America may be less expensive than relocating to a country in Europe or Asia. Additionally, the accessibility of your destination can impact shipping costs. Countries with well-established ports and transportation networks tend to have more competitive rates.
  • Shipping Method: The choice of shipping method also affects your moving costs. There are typically two primary methods for international moves: airfreight and sea freight. Air freight is faster but more expensive, while sea freight is cost-effective but slower. The volume and weight of your belongings will further influence your decision and the corresponding costs.
  • Shipment Size and Weight: The volume and weight of your belongings have a direct correlation with the cost of international moving. The more items you intend to transport, the higher the cost. To keep expenses in check, consider downsizing and decluttering before your move. Reducing the number of items you need to transport can significantly impact your moving budget.
  • Packing and Crating: Properly packing and crating your belongings is essential to protect them during international transit. Many moving companies offer packing and crating services, and these services are typically billed separately. The complexity of items, such as fragile or valuable objects, will impact packing costs.
  • Customs and Duties: Customs and duties vary from one country to another. It's crucial to be aware of the regulations and tariffs in both Nicaragua and your destination country. Failure to comply with customs requirements can lead to delays and additional costs. Consulting with a professional moving company that specializes in international relocations can help navigate these complexities.
  • Insurance: Insuring your belongings during an international move is a smart decision. The cost of insurance depends on the total value of your items and the coverage you choose. It's advisable to assess your insurance options and select a policy that provides peace of mind while keeping your budget in mind.
  • Destination Services: Upon arrival in your destination country, you may require services such as unpacking, assembly, and transportation to your new residence. These services come at an additional cost and should be factored into your budget when planning your international move.
  • Choice of Moving Company: The selection of an international moving company also plays a significant role in determining your overall moving costs. Different companies offer various services and pricing models. It's essential to obtain multiple quotes, compare services, and assess customer reviews to find a reliable and cost-effective moving partner.
  • Average International Moving Cost in Nicaragua: While specific costs can vary widely depending on the factors mentioned above, it's possible to provide a general idea of the average international moving cost for a typical household. For a full-service international move to or from Nicaragua, including packing, shipping, customs clearance, and destination services, the cost can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, depending on the distance and destination.

Average International Moving Prices in Nicaragua

  1. Local and Regional Moves: For international moves within Central America or to nearby countries, the average cost can range from $1,000 to $7,000 for a standard two-bedroom household. Prices may vary based on the factors mentioned above.
  2. Intercontinental Moves: Moving to continents like Europe, Asia, or the Americas can significantly increase the cost. On average, you can expect to pay between $10,000 and $20,000 for a two-bedroom household. The exact cost depends on the distance, shipping method, and volume of goods.
  3. Additional Services: International moving companies often offer extra services such as storage, packing, unpacking, and insurance. These services can add to the overall cost, but they can also make your move more convenient.
